#include "functions.h"
#include <stddef.h> /* NULL size_t */
#include <stdio.h> /* snprintf() */
#include <stdlib.h> /* free() */
#include <string.h> /* memset() strcmp() strlen() */
#include "../compat/reallocarray.h"
#include "../utils/str.h"
#include "completion.h"
#include "text_buffer.h"
#include "var.h"
static int add_function(const function_t *func_info);
static function_t * find_function(const char func_name[]);
/* Number of registered functions. */
static size_t function_count;
/* List of registered functions. */
static function_t *functions;
int
function_register(const function_t *func_info)
{
if(function_registered(func_info->name))
{
return 1;
}
if(add_function(func_info) != 0)
{
return 1;
}
return 0;
}
int
function_registered(const char func_name[])
{
return find_function(func_name) != NULL;
}
/* Adds function to the list of functions. Returns non-zero on error. */
static int
add_function(const function_t *func_info)
{
function_t *ptr;
if(func_info->args.min > func_info->args.max)
{
return 1;
}
ptr = reallocarray(functions, function_count + 1, sizeof(function_t));
if(ptr == NULL)
{
return 1;
}
functions = ptr;
functions[function_count++] = *func_info;
return 0;
}
var_t
function_call(const char func_name[], const call_info_t *call_info)
{
function_t *function = find_function(func_name);
if(function == NULL)
{
vle_tb_append_linef(vle_err, "%s: %s", "Unknown function", func_name);
return var_error();
}
if(call_info->argc < function->args.min)
{
vle_tb_append_linef(vle_err, "%s: %s", "Not enough arguments for function",
func_name);
return var_error();
}
if(call_info->argc > function->args.max)
{
vle_tb_append_linef(vle_err, "%s: %s", "Too many arguments for function",
func_name);
return var_error();
}
return function->ptr(call_info);
}
/* Searches for function with specified name. Returns NULL in case of failed
* search. */
static function_t *
find_function(const char func_name[])
{
size_t i;
for(i = 0; i < function_count; i++)
{
if(strcmp(functions[i].name, func_name) == 0)
{
return &functions[i];
}
}
return NULL;
}
void
function_reset_all(void)
{
free(functions);
functions = NULL;
function_count = 0U;
}
void
function_complete_name(const char str[], const char **start)
{
size_t i;
size_t len;
*start = str;
len = strlen(str);
for(i = 0U; i < function_count; ++i)
{
const function_t *const func = &functions[i];
if(starts_withn(func->name, str, len))
{
vle_compl_put_match(format_str("%s(", func->name), func->descr);
}
}
vle_compl_finish_group();
vle_compl_add_last_match(str);
}
void
function_call_info_init(call_info_t *call_info, int interactive)
{
memset(call_info, 0, sizeof(*call_info));
call_info->interactive = interactive;
}
void
function_call_info_add_arg(call_info_t *call_info, var_t var)
{
var_t *ptr;
ptr = reallocarray(call_info->argv, call_info->argc + 1, sizeof(var_t));
if(ptr == NULL)
{
return;
}
ptr[call_info->argc++] = var;
call_info->argv = ptr;
}
void
function_call_info_free(call_info_t *call_info)
{
size_t i;
for(i = 0; i < call_info->argc; i++)
{
var_free(call_info->argv[i]);
}
free(call_info->argv);
call_info->argv = NULL;
call_info->argc = 0;
}
